Sift up heap

WebThe gamsat is a long process for most so don’t expect to be able to fill in all your holes of background knowledge and drill practice questions and dust up maths and study s1+2 etc etc all for the first go. Whatever you do know will benefit later sits also. But for this sit I’d say go through topic lists to learn theory but also do ... Web10 hours ago · You'll have to sift through heaps of direct comparisons to famous horror, thriller, and even action adventure movies that clearly inspire director Julius Avery's vision, …

Priority queue (maximum pile) - Programmer Sought

WebAug 5, 2015 · To add an element to a heap we must perform an up-heap operation (also known as bubble-up, percolate-up, sift-up, trickle-up, heapify-up, or cascade-up), by following this algorithm: Add the element to the bottom level of the heap (insertion done). Compare the added element with its parent; if they are in the correct order, stop (siftup begins ... Web66°North. Sep 2006 - Nov 20071 year 3 months. I was head of all marketing activity for 66°North. 66°North is Iceland's leading outdoor wear brand, and a well known premium outdoor brand in numerous European countries. Currently 66°North is selling its products in 15 countries, including the USA. www.66north.is. optex ftn-rrhw https://ltcgrow.com

Python heapq._siftdown function explanation - Stack Overflow

WebTwo original operations: SIFT-UP and SIFT-DOWN. There are two most primitive operations behind a series of basic operations, calledSIFT-UP (Floating) and SIFT-DOWN (sink) Take the maximum heap as an example, when a node does not meet the stack of the largest heap WebPython - Heaps. Heap is a special tree structure in which each parent node is less than or equal to its child node. Then it is called a Min Heap. If each parent node is greater than or equal to its child node then it is called a max heap. It is very useful is implementing priority queues where the queue item with higher weightage is given more ... WebBinaryHeap::sift_up. Bubbling an element up a heap is a bit more complicated than extending a Vec. The pseudocode is as follows: bubble_up(heap, index): while index != 0 && heap[index] ... bubble_up(heap, index): let end_index = index; while end_index != 0 && heap[end_index] < heap[parent(end_index)]: end_index = parent (end_index ... optex fa bgs

Exception Safety - The Rustonomicon

Category:S3 - Systematic Vs. Practiced Approach. What worked best for you …

Tags:Sift up heap

Sift up heap

siftUp and siftDown operation in heap for heapifying an …

WebDec 17, 2004 · (algorithm) Definition: Restoring the heap property by swapping a node with its parent, and repeating the process on the parent until the root is reached or the heap … WebTotal Up-heap-val Spring 2024 Sacramento State - Cook - CSc 130 15 Just to make matters confusing, up-heap is also known by various other terms – which are all valid These are some: • bubble-up • percolate-up • sift-up • heapify-up • cascade-up Deleting a node is quite different from adding Heaps must maintain completeness

Sift up heap

Did you know?

WebApr 11, 2024 · Here's some memorable moments from Princess Eugenie's wedding. Post continues below. Video via Mamamia. It was a gorgeous day full of laughs, wonderful people, good food and lots of drinking and dancing (emphasis on the drinking). Anyway, there were a few things I didn't expect and I'm going to just assume you'll want to hear … WebSift up the new element, while heap property is broken. Sifting is done as following: compare node's value with parent's value. If they are in wrong order, swap them. Example. Insert -2 …

WebThe DELETE operation is based on `SIFT DOWN', which, as the name suggests, is the exact opposite of SIFT UP. SIFT DOWN starts with a value in any node. It moves the value down the tree by successively exchanging the value with the smaller of its two children. The operation continues until the value reaches a position where it is less than both ... WebThe DELETE operation is based on `SIFT DOWN', which, as the name suggests, is the exact opposite of SIFT UP. SIFT DOWN starts with a value in any node. It moves the value down …

WebDownload this Sifted Flour pouring on a Heap of Flour photo from Canva's impressive stock photo library. WebApr 14, 2024 · The clock is ticking for Amazon sellers with heaps of stale products at FBA! New fees tied to your storage utilization ratio and aged inventory are set to take effect in April.

WebSep 15, 2024 · To add an element to a heap we must perform an up-heap operation (also known as bubble-up, percolate-up, sift-up, trickle-up, swim-up, heapify-up, or cascade-up), by following this algorithm: Add the element to the bottom level of the heap. Compare the added element with its parent; if they are in the correct order, stop.

WebReplace the root of the heap with the last element on the last level. Compare the new root with its children; if they are in the correct order, stop. If not, swap the element with one of its children and return to the previous step. (Swap with its smaller child in a min-heap and its larger child in a max-heap.) Steps. optex energy switchWebA Catalogue of Algorithms for Building Weak Heaps ... A framework for speeding up priority queue operations. 2004 • Amr Elmasry. Download Free PDF View PDF. Discrete Mathematics, Algorithms and Applications. FAT HEAPS WITHOUT REGULAR COUNTERS. 2013 • Amr Elmasry. optex dual tech harsh environment motionWebSplHeap::compare — Compare elements in order to place them correctly in the heap while sifting up. SplHeap::count — Counts the number of elements in the heap. SplHeap::current — Return current node pointed by the iterator. SplHeap::extract — Extracts a node from top of the heap and sift up. SplHeap::insert — Inserts an element in the ... optex fa oppd-15WebThe Temple Mount Sifting Project is a unique initiative accessible to the public. In the 1990s, heaps of soil with unimaginable archaeological artifacts were illegally dug up and removed from the Temple Mount compound. This soil collection is now providing rare insight into the archaeology of the Temple Mount, which has never before been ... optex cortinaWebAug 18, 2024 · HeapQ Heapify Time Complexity in Python. Turn a list into a heap via heapq.heapify. If you ever need to turn a list into a heap, this is the function for you. heapq.heapify () turns a list into a ... optex earsWebMay 22, 2015 · The interesting property of a heap is that a[0] is always its smallest element. For the sift down, it just bubbles down a bigger value to its correct place, for example … optex chime box s-rc5WebInterface 接口 • O(logN) Push -> Sift Up • O(logN) Pop -> Sift Down • O(1) Top • O(N) Delete. Heap Application. ... The default PriorityQueue is implemented with Min-Heap, that is the … optex hx80